Freeze Dried Durian by Kentary
Utilizing freeze-drying (lyophilization), durian flesh is rapidly frozen at extremely low temperatures and then dried under vacuum, allowing the ice to sublimate directly into vapor. This process preserves cell structure, flavor, and nutrients, resulting in a crispy and flavorful snack.
Freeze Dried Durian Production Process
Kentary applies a closed-loop production system with strict hygiene and quality control from sourcing to packaging. The process includes the following steps:
- Durian Selection: Only high-quality, ripe Dak Lak durians are selected. Fruits must have large, thick pods, golden flesh, strong fragrance, and no signs of damage or spoilage. Only qualified fruits are used.
- Pre-processing: Durian is carefully separated from the seeds. Depending on product format, the flesh may be cut into bite-sized pieces. This stage is carried out in a hygienic environment.
- IQF – Individually Quick Frozen: Durian flesh is flash frozen at temperatures from -50°C to -80°C. Rapid freezing forms small ice crystals, preserving cell integrity, flavor, and nutrition.
- Freeze Drying: The frozen pieces are placed in a vacuum chamber where water sublimates directly into vapor. This process takes 24 to 48 hours, ensuring maximum retention of flavor, color, and nutrients.
- Packing: Dried durian at 3% moisture is packed in multi-layer pouches with moisture, UV, and oxidation protection. Available in 200g, 400g, and 800g, shelf-stable for up to 12 months without preservatives.
Nutritional Composition and Health Benefits
Freeze dried durian by Kentary is rich in carbohydrates, fiber, potassium, B vitamins, and antioxidants, offering numerous health advantages:
- Energy: High energy source – ideal for active individuals.
- Fiber: Supports digestion, prevents constipation, maintains healthy gut flora. 100g contains about 3.8g fiber (USDA).
- Potassium: Regulates blood pressure, supports muscle and nerve function. 100g provides ~436mg potassium.
- Vitamin B: B1, B2, B6 aid in energy metabolism and brain function.
- Antioxidants: Includes vitamin C and E, protecting cells from oxidative stress and reducing chronic disease risk.
Note: Diabetics, individuals with obesity or heart issues should consume cautiously due to natural sugars and fats. Consult a healthcare provider before use for medical purposes.

FAQ
1. How does freeze dried durian compare to chewy and traditionally dried durian?
| Attribute | Freeze Dried Durian | Chewy Durian | Traditional Dried Durian |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nutrition | Best retained | Moderately retained | Significantly reduced |
| Flavor | Natural, creamy-sweet | Richer, denser | Caramelized, slightly burnt |
| Texture | Crispy and airy | Chewy | Dry and hard |
| Shelf life | 12-18 months | 6-12 months | 3-6 months |
